What are the technical document requirements for Class II medical device registration with ANVISA?

For Class II medical device registration with ANVISA (Agência Nacional de Vigilância Sanitária) in Brazil, a comprehensive set of technical documents must be prepared and submitted as part of your application.

The requirements can vary based on the specific device and its intended use, but generally, the following technical document requirements are expected:

Technical Document Requirements

  1. Device Description

    • A detailed description of the medical device, including:
      • Device name and model.
      • Intended use and indications.
      • Product specifications (dimensions, materials, performance characteristics).
      • Diagrams or photographs that illustrate the device.
  2. Manufacturing Information

    • Information regarding the manufacturing process, including:
      • Description of the manufacturing facility.
      • Equipment and technology used in production.
      • Quality control processes.
      • Information about suppliers of critical components.
  3. Risk Management

    • A comprehensive risk analysis following ISO 14971, which includes:
      • Identification of potential hazards associated with the device.
      • Risk assessment and evaluation of risks.
      • Mitigation strategies and controls implemented to manage risks.
  4. Clinical Evaluation

    • A Clinical Evaluation Report that provides evidence of safety and efficacy, which may include:
      • Results from clinical studies, if applicable.
      • Literature reviews demonstrating the performance and safety of similar devices.
      • Post-market surveillance data if the device has been marketed elsewhere.
  5. Quality Management System (QMS) Documentation

    • Evidence of a Quality Management System that complies with ISO 13485, which may include:
      • ISO 13485 certification.
      • Quality manual and policies.
      • Procedures related to design control, production, and post-market activities.
      • Recent audit reports.
  6. Labeling Information

    • Draft labels and instructions for use in Portuguese, including:
      • Clear and accurate product labeling with all necessary warnings, precautions, and contraindications.
      • User instructions that detail proper use, maintenance, and disposal of the device.
  7. Declaration of Conformity

    • A document that states the device complies with applicable Brazilian regulations and standards, including references to relevant regulations.
  8. Post-Market Surveillance Plan

    • If applicable, a plan for post-market surveillance that outlines how you will monitor the device’s performance after it has been placed on the market.
  9. Legal Representation Documentation (if applicable)

    • For foreign manufacturers, a letter appointing a Brazilian legal representative, confirming their role as your point of contact with ANVISA.

Preparation Tips

  • Organization: Ensure that the technical documentation is well-organized and includes a table of contents for easy navigation.
  • Clarity: Use clear and concise language in all documents, avoiding jargon and technical terms without explanations.
  • Compliance: Regularly check ANVISA’s guidelines and ensure all documents meet the current regulatory requirements.
